Prithvi Shaw became unsold in IPL 2025 auction despite a decent record
Prithvi Shaw was unsold in the IPL 2025 auction in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ia, after Delhi’s capitals, he was released after seven sessions with the franchise. The initial batsman made his IPL debut with the team in 2018.
cricketballgame.com
Shaw has scored an average of 23.94 in 79 IPL matches and has a strike rate of over 147. In total, they have 117 T20 to 2,902 runs at a strike rate of 151.54, including one century and 20 half -centuries.
In the 2024 IPL season, he scored 198 runs in eight matches for Delhi Capital and on an average a strike of 24.75 and 163.63. He failed to attract dialects from the franchise during the auction.
CSK IPL 2025 to sign Prithvi Shaw to revive the team after the crisis
Meanwhile, the five -time champion Chennai Super Kings had a forgetful season in the IPL 2025. They ended at the bottom of the table with just four wins out of 14 matches. The team struggled with batting for most of the season, but finally showed only a slight improvement.
The initial combination of CSK failed to provide a solid start, and the initial injury of Captain Ruturaj Gikwad further weakened this side. Players like Rahul Tripathi, Rachin Rabindra, and Devon Conway struggled at the top, forcing the team to experiment with openers like Sheikh Rashid and Ayush Mahetre.
CSK needs an aggressive opener who can attack the bowlers. Shaw, with its attacker style, can be an ideal fit, while the Gaekwad going to number three will add stability and depth to the middle order.

Shaw made his international debut for India in 2018. He played five Tests, scoring an average of 339 runs at 42.37, including a century and two fifties. Shaw has also appeared in six Odis and a single T20I, with his last international outing against Sri Lanka in July 2021.
